What Are the Most Common Signs Your Sump Pump Is Failing?

Spotting problems early provides homeowners important time to arrange emergency sump pump repair San Diego before major flooding happens. Many property owners commonly observe issues when water pools on the floor. The main signs your sump pump is failing include strange grinding or humming noises from the motor area, the unit running non-stop even when the pit looks empty (known as short-cycling), absolute lack of activation during rainfall, apparent rust or corrosion on the housing, and an unusual burning odor that indicates electrical or motor strain.

These indicators commonly arise from blocked intake screens that block proper water flow, failing or stuck float switches, motors running beyond capacity, or blocked discharge lines that force water back into the pit. In San Diego’s diverse terrain, particles from local runoff and variable groundwater tables increase these problems, particularly in properties near the 15 Freeway or in hillside communities. A pump that cycles constantly uses electricity and risks premature burnout, while silence during needed operation signals urgent danger.

Unusual Noises and Vibrations

Scraping noises usually signal material has gotten into the impeller and is affecting internal components. Constant humming commonly indicates the motor struggles against blockage or failing bearings. Ignoring these noises lets damage to progress, eventually demanding full replacement rather than straightforward repair.

Tremors can also indicate improper alignment or loose mounting. Residents should pay close attention during rain events, as quick recognition through sound alone can avoid extensive water intrusion. Professional technicians use specialized equipment to locate the exact source and return quiet, efficient operation.

Constant or Short-Cycling Operation

When the pump turns on and off in rapid succession, power use rises and mechanical wear grows dramatically. Frequent culprits feature misadjusted or contaminated float switches, overwhelming groundwater inflow that overtaxes capacity, or an undersized unit for the property’s flow demands.

Short-cycling also taxes electrical components and decreases overall lifespan. People in high-water-table areas experience this more frequently. Tuning switch height or enhancing pump capacity resolves the issue and reestablishes normal performance.

Pump Not Activating During Heavy Rain

This is the most dangerous symptom. Adding a bucket of water into the pit gives a quick test—if the pump fails to activate, prompt emergency sump pump repair San Diego is necessary. Causes include blown circuits to jammed motors or broken check valves.

Electrical problems, faulty connections, or disconnected wiring also stop activation. In storm situations, this malfunction allows rapid water accumulation. Prompt professional response reduces damage and reestablishes protection.

Visible Wear, Rust, or Water Leaks Around the Unit

Why Do Sump Pumps Fail So Often in San Diego Homes?

The mix of San Diego’s coastal climate, soil composition, and terrain diversity creates demanding conditions for sump pumps. Residences on slopes face stronger groundwater flow, expansive clay soils retain moisture for prolonged periods, and abrupt heavy rainfall following prolonged drought imposes sudden demand on systems that may have been inactive.

Power failures during storms disconnect electricity to standard pumps, while local runoff carries fine sediment that builds up in pits and lines. Many residences rely on sewage ejector pumps rather than traditional clean-water units, introducing additional solids-handling stress that increases wear.

Power Outages and Lack of Battery Backup

Storms in San Diego commonly cause brief or extended blackouts. Standard electric pumps cease operation immediately, putting homes vulnerable. A battery backup sump pump provides automatic continuation, pumping for hours on stored power.

Water-powered backups provide an alternative utilizing municipal pressure. Both options show essential when grid power fails during peak need. Many local flooding incidents stem directly to this avoidable cause.

Clogged Intake Screens and Discharge Lines

Fine particles from runoff accumulate on intake screens, reducing water entry. Discharge lines develop blockages from debris or freezing in rare cold snaps. Decreased flow forces the motor to work harder, leading to excessive heat and failure.

Professional drain cleaning and line flushing return full capacity. Consistent attention to these areas extends system life considerably.

Faulty Float Switches and Motor Overload

Float switches get stuck from mineral buildup or physical debris. Motors experience overheating when running against resistance or in continuous cycles. Both issues appear more often in high-demand San Diego installations.

Replacement switches and motor diagnostics fix these mechanical problems reliably. Technicians check load capacity to ensure the unit matches property requirements.

Groundwater Pressure in Hillside & Low-Lying Areas

Higher hydrostatic pressure in sloped or below-grade lots forces water aggressively into basements. Constant exposure degrades seals, bearings, and impellers faster than in level properties.

Upgraded pump models with higher head pressure ratings handle these conditions better. Proper sizing during installation or replacement avoids ongoing strain.

Sump Pump vs Sewage Ejector Pump: Which One Do You Have?

A common source of confusion among San Diego homeowners relates to separating between clean-water sump pumps and sewage ejector pumps. Misidentification results in unsuitable repairs and persistent issues.

Clean-water units manage groundwater only, while ejector models treat wastewater carrying solids from lower-level fixtures. Many homes in sloped or low areas need the latter because gravity drainage is impossible.

Key Design and Function Differences

Standard sump pumps include open impellers designed for clear water flow. Sewage ejector pumps incorporate grinding or vortex mechanisms to handle toilet paper, waste, and larger particles without clogging.

This essential difference affects component selection, maintenance frequency, and repair techniques. Using the wrong approach risks rapid re-failure.

Typical Locations in San Diego Homes

Ejector systems appear frequently in finished basements, downhill properties, or additions built below sewer line level. Knowing location helps determine system type quickly.

Maintenance Requirements for Each Type

Clean-water models need periodic pit cleaning and switch testing. Ejector units call for more frequent solids removal and grinder inspection to preserve performance.

Signs of Failure Specific to Each System

Clean-water failures exhibit rising water levels. Ejector problems commonly involve foul odors or fixture backups. Precise diagnosis ensures proper repair path.

How Much Does Emergency Sump Pump Repair Cost in San Diego?

Transparent cost expectations reduce anxiety during urgent situations. Typical emergency sump pump repair San Diego costs go from $400 to $1,200, while total replacements and upgrades reach $800 to $2,500.

Elements involve part prices, labor time, after-hours premiums, and whether preventive additions like battery backup are installed simultaneously. Residents appreciate being aware of these factors upfront.

Breakdown of Common Repair Costs

Float switch replacement typically costs $100 to $300 installed. Motor rebuilds or replacements run $200 to $500. Check valve or discharge pipe fixes increase $150 to $400. After-hours service calls can add $50 to $150 premium fees.

These figures represent local market rates for professional work with quality parts. Reduced quotes sometimes point to shortcuts that lead to repeat problems.

Factors That Influence Final Pricing

Pump type (clean-water vs ejector), location of the pit, extent of water damage already present, and required upgrades all impact totals. Evaluation time also adds when causes are complex.

Frequently Asked Questions About Emergency Sump Pump Repair in San Diego

What causes a sump pump to run constantly?

Non-stop operation usually is caused by high groundwater inflow, a stuck or blocked float switch, or an undersized pump working hard to keep up. In San Diego’s fluctuating water table areas, this symptom appears frequently. Expert evaluation identifies whether cleaning, switch replacement, or capacity upgrade is needed. How can I test if my sump pump is working properly?

Gradually pour several buckets of water into the pit until the float rises and the pump activates. Listen for normal operation and verify water exits through the discharge line. No response or strange noises show the need for service. Periodic testing prevents surprise failures.

Are sewage ejector pumps different from regular sump pumps?
